Which integer is known as the multiplicative identity?
Show answer
1
Step 1: The multiplicative identity is the number that, when multiplied with any integer, gives the same integer. Step 2: Let us check: 5 × 1 = 5, (-12) × 1 = -12, 0 × 1 = 0. Step 3: In every case, multiplying by 1 gives the number itself. Step 4: The number 0 is the additive identity, not the multiplicative identity. Final Answer: 1 is the multiplicative identity because a × 1 = a for every integer a.
Evaluate using DMAS: 18 ÷ 6 + 4 × 2
Show answer
11
Step 1: The expression is 18 ÷ 6 + 4 × 2. Using DMAS, we do Division first, then Multiplication, then Addition, then Subtraction. Step 2: Division: 18 ÷ 6 = 3. Expression becomes: 3 + 4 × 2. Step 3: Multiplication: 4 × 2 = 8. Expression becomes: 3 + 8. Step 4: Addition: 3 + 8 = 11. Final Answer: 11. A common mistake is doing addition before multiplication, which would give a wrong answer.
What is the sign of the product of 5 negative integers?
Show answer
Negative
Step 1: We need to find the sign when 5 negative integers are multiplied. Step 2: The rule is — the product of an ODD number of negative integers is always NEGATIVE. Step 3: The product of an EVEN number of negative integers is always POSITIVE. Step 4: Since 5 is an odd number, the product of 5 negative integers will be negative. Final Answer: Negative. For example, (-1) × (-1) × (-1) × (-1) × (-1) = -1, which is negative.
